SIDE AIRBAGS
(SIDE BAG – WINDOW BAG)
Purpose of the side airbags is to in-
crease passenger protection in the
event of a side impact of medium to
high severity.
Side airbags consist of an instantly
inflatable bag:
- the side bag is housed in the front
seat backs. This solution ensures that
the bag is always in an optimal posi-
tion with respect to the passenger, re-
gardless of the seat position;
- since the window bag is a "win-
dow" system it is housed in the roof
side covering, masked with a proper
finishing that enables bag deflation
downwards. This solution has been
studied for protecting the head and
therefore to offer the best passenger
protection in the event of a side im-
pact. The "window" solution offers
the aforesaid top protection perfor-
mance through the wide deflation sur-
face and the self-supporting charac-
teristics, the same type of protection
is also offered to rear seat passengers.
In the event of a side collision the
electronic control unit processes the
signals coming from a deceleration
sensor and, if required, fires the bags.
The bag inflates instantly and acts
as a soft protective barrier between
the body of the front seat passengers
and the car door. The bag deflates im-
mediately afterwards.
In the event of side collisions at low
speed, the restraining action of the
seat belts is sufficient and the airbag
is not inflated.
The airbag, as a consequence, is not
a replacement for the use of seat belts
but rather a complement. We recom-
mend that seat belts are worn at all
times as prescribed by legislation in
Europe and most other countries
world-wide.
Side airbags are not deactivated by
front airbag switch operation, as de-
scribed in the previous paragraph and
therefore in the event of side impact,
protection is guaranteed also to any
child carried on the front passenger
seat.
IMPORTANT The front and/or side
airbags can be triggered if the car is
involved in hard impacts or collisions
in the area of the underbody, e.g.: vi-
olent impacts against steps, kerbs or
projecting objects fixed to the ground,
or if the car falls into large pot-holes
or dips in the road surface.
IMPORTANT When the airbag is
fired it emits a small amount of pow-
ders and smoke. This is not harmful
and does not indicate the beginning of
a fire. Furthermore the surface of the
inflated bag and the passenger com-
partment may be covered with pow-
dery residues. This powder may irri-
tate skin and eyes. In the event of ex-
posure, wash with mild soap and wa-
ter.
